The Quartus II software automatically selects the power down channel feature, which
takes effect when you configure the Arria II GX or GZ device. All unused transceiver
channels and blocks are powered down to reduce overall power consumption.
The gxb_powerdown signal is an optional transceiver block signal. It powers down all
the blocks in the transceiver block. The minimum pulse width for this signal is 1 s.
